Fortnite: A Phenomenon in the Gaming World

Fortnite is a multiplayer online battle royale game developed by Epic Games. It was first released in 2017 and quickly gained popularity among players of all ages. The game’s success can be attributed to several factors, including its engaging gameplay, frequent updates, and collaboration with popular brands and celebrities.

According to a report by Statista, Fortnite generated $3.6 billion in revenue in 2019. This includes revenue from in-game purchases, such as skins, weapons, and items, as well as advertising and sponsorship deals. One of the game’s most successful marketing campaigns involved partnering with popular brands like Nike and Marvel to create exclusive in-game content, which helped boost its popularity even further.

Minecraft: A Timeless Classic

Minecraft is a sandbox-style adventure game created by Markus Persson and later developed by Mojang Studios. It was first released in 2009 and has since become one of the most popular games of all time, with over 200 million copies sold worldwide.

In terms of revenue, Minecraft has generated over $3 billion in revenue since its release. The game’s success can be attributed to several factors, including its wide appeal, frequent updates, and strong community support. Minecraft also offers a variety of ways for players to monetize their content, such as selling their creations on the game’s marketplace or streaming their gameplay on platforms like Twitch.

Grand Theft Auto V: A Cultural Phenomenon

Grand Theft Auto V is an open-world action-adventure game developed by Rockstar Games. It was first released in 2013 and has since become one of the most successful games of all time, with over $6 billion in revenue generated worldwide.

The success of Grand Theft Auto V can be attributed to several factors, including its engaging storyline, immersive gameplay, and strong attention to detail. The game also features a wide range of content, including missions, side quests, and activities, which help keep players engaged for hours on end. Additionally, the game’s online mode, called GTA Online, offers a variety of multiplayer experiences that allow players to interact with each other in unique ways.

Case Studies: Real-Life Examples of Successful Video Games

There are many other examples of successful video games that have generated significant revenue. For example, Pokémon Go is a mobile augmented reality game developed by Niantic that has generated over $2 billion in revenue since its release in 2016. Similarly, League of Legends is a multiplayer online battle arena game developed by Riot Games that has generated over $2.7 billion in revenue since its release in 2009.

FAQs: Common Questions About Video Game Revenue

1. How do video games generate revenue?

Video games generate revenue through a variety of means, including in-game purchases, advertising and sponsorship deals, and merchandise sales.

2. What is the difference between a single-player and multiplayer game?

A single-player game is designed for one player to play alone, while a multiplayer game is designed for two or more players to play together online or locally.

3. Which video game has sold the most copies of all time?

As of 2021, Minecraft holds the record for selling the most copies of all time, with over 200 million copies sold worldwide.

4. What is esports?

Esports is a competitive form of gaming that involves professional players competing in organized tournaments and events.
